收藏
回答

map点位聚合,如果点位之间距离太近以至于点击聚合点后点位不能分散开,请问怎样知道点击后是否分散?

正常状态是点击聚合点,点位会分散开,但是点位之间距离过近,就会出现聚合点不能散开的情况,现在的需求就是确认当前点击的聚合点是否是无法展开的集合,不知大佬们有没有什么思路?

还有一个问题就是markerClusterCreate,文档是这样介绍的:‘缩放或拖动导致新的聚合簇产生时触发,仅返回新创建的聚合簇信息。’;但测试下来,即使没有新的聚合簇产生也会触发,不知是否是个bug,目前只在安卓上进行了测试。

回答关注问题邀请回答
收藏

2 个回答

  • T imer
    T imer
    2021-05-19

    同碰到这个问题

    2021-05-19
    有用
    回复 1
    • T imer
      T imer
      2021-05-19
      找到解决办法了 在MapContext.initMarkerCluster(Object object)里设置gridSize 越小 放大时就会越分散 但是太小了聚合效果不好 需要取舍
      2021-05-19
      1
      回复
  • 文心
    文心
    2021-04-16

    这是定位精度的问题

    2021-04-16
    有用
    回复 2
    • W
      W
      2021-04-17
      怎么说,聚合点不能散开不是因为点位距离过近导致的?
      2021-04-17
      回复
    •  
       
      2022-01-14
      楼主解决了吗,同遇到这个问题
      2022-01-14
      回复
登录 后发表内容
问题标签